Will Smith has spoken out about his marriage following Rebel Wilson's dig at him and Jada Pinkett Smith at the 2022 BAFTAs last weekend.

The Australian actress, who hosted the event, made viewers rather uncomfortable when she poked fun at Will and Jada's marriage after Will won Best Film Actor in a Leading Role for his performance in King Richard.

Although Will and Jada were absent from the event - attending the Critics Choice Awards in Los Angeles on the same night - it seems that the Fresh Prince actor may have heard about Rebel's comments.

Advert

Will had been speaking on CBS Sunday Morning after also winning Best Actor in a Leading Role at the Critics Choice Awards when he decided to set the record straight about his marriage once and for all.

Speaking to Gayle King, Will insisted that there had "never been infidelity" in his marriage.

He added: "Jada and I talk about everything. We have never surprised one another with anything ever."


After landing the award for Best Actor at the BAFTAs, Pitch Perfect star Rebel Wilson raised eyebrows when she joked: "I thought his best performance over the past year was being OK with all his wife’s boyfriends."

Fans of the Smith family were shocked when Jada and Will revealed that they have an open marriage during an episode of her Facebook show Red Table Talk.

In 2020, Jada confirmed she had an ‘entanglement’ with R&B singer August Alsina. The spouses were separated at the time. 

Last year, Will confirmed that he had also had a relationship with another woman during his marriage and confirmed the pair actually have an open marriage.

Following Rebel's dig at Will, those who were tuned in to the BAFTAs took to Twitter to express their disappointment.

"Rebel Wilson didn’t have to make that joke about Will and Jada lol so uncalled for man. #BAFTAs” tweeted one viewer.

Another Twitter user wrote: “That Rebel Wilson Will Smith/Jada joke didn't land at all. Just awful.”
